Defeating Stone Talus Bosses:
When facing a Stone Talus boss, it's important to remember that they have a rock exterior that provides them with high defense against traditional attacks. To defeat a Stone Talus, you'll need to target its weak spots, which are the ore deposits found on its body. These weak points are glowing and are usually located on the Stone Talus's back, arms, or legs. You can climb onto the Stone Talus to reach these weak spots, but be cautious of its attacks, as they can shake you off.
One effective strategy for defeating a Stone Talus is to use ranged attacks such as arrows to target its weak spots from a distance. Aim for the glowing ore deposits to deal significant damage to the Stone Talus. Additionally, you can use elemental arrows such as bomb arrows or fire arrows to increase the damage dealt to the boss. Another approach is to use the Stasis rune to temporarily immobilize the Stone Talus, allowing you to climb onto it safely and attack its weak points.
It's important to note that different types of Stone Talus bosses exist in the game, including regular Stone Talus, Frost Talus, and Igneo Talus. Each type has its own unique abilities and weaknesses, so adjust your strategy accordingly. For example, Frost Talus bosses are vulnerable to fire-based attacks, while Igneo Talus bosses are weak against ice-based attacks.
As you progress through the game, you may encounter higher-level Stone Talus bosses known as Rare Stone Talus. These tougher enemies have more health and deal increased damage, so be prepared for a challenging battle. To defeat Rare Stone Talus bosses, it's recommended to use powerful weapons, armor, and cooking recipes that boost your attack and defense stats.
